well thank you...araucana's carry a death gene and these were shipped so I'll be happy how ever many hatch! I have 15 chicks varying ages but all under 3 months in the house due to our weather here!! an incubator full of eggs due to hatch through out the rest of the month...yes I'm busy!!
all my chickens that are old enough to stay out in any weather have done perfectly fine! I'm so pleased! my husband built the coops so well that their water was only iced over a few nights when it got into the teens!!
I've been taking the younger ones out during the warmer part of the day ( 39-40 degrees) then bringing them in for the night...the room they are in ( my dining room
hmm.png
) is kept 60ish so they can acclimate...as hard as it is we do try not to baby them....so they can survive without a lot of artificial help.
 
Yes Araucana are harder to hatch because of their cheek feathers, too I hear. They sure lay pretty eggs, I have about 10 americanas currently, 8 of which I hatched. I like the shades. My americanas have cheek feathers too.
